Northwest Houston is a sprawling sector of the city that’s home to several prominent neighborhoods. Tree-lined streets, paved sidewalks, and upscale homes are spread throughout Northwest Houston, but there are also pockets where you’ll find affordable apartments and houses for rent as well. Enjoy the park-like atmosphere that accompanies this district that’s home to Bear Creek Pioneers Park. This expansive wooded park is known for its abundant wildlife like deer and ducks, offering trails, fields, and more. Residents appreciate the easy access to inner-city neighborhoods like Downtown, Uptown, and Midtown Houston.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
